10 simple reasons to choose Embley, Prep School
Independent prep school and nursery in Romsey.
For pupils aged 2 to 11 years.
Mixed school (about 50%/50%).
Day school.
Not a school of religious character.
Non-selective admissions policy.
Small school with an average of one class per year.
Prep school to Embley, an all-through school to age 18.
Embley, Prep School fees range from £3,632 (Rec) to £5,579 per term (2021/22).
10 better reasons to choose Embley, Prep School
Schoolsmith Score®; 83.
One of the best independent prep schools in Romsey and one of the 3 best primary schools for 5 miles.
On average, 20.3 pupils per class and 7.6 pupils per teacher, from Year 1.
Most Embley Prep pupils move up to the senior school at the end of Year 6.
School curriculum is based on the National Curriculum with some additions and variations. It also includes PSHE, reasoning, philosophy, French, Spanish. The school offers a handful of extra-curricular academic activities or hobby clubs.
Specialist teachers for sport, music, languages, art, DT and computing throughout, and for most subjects from Year 3.
School operates a Learning Outside the Classroom programme.
School offers over 15 different sports through the year, through both the curriculum and extra-curriculum. Representative teams in major sports from Year 3.
Art, music and drama are taught as discrete curricular subjects to all pupils. Choir, orchestra and one or two instrument ensembles. The school offers a handful of extra-curricular creative and performing arts clubs.
Wraparound care from 8.00am to 6.00pm. Nursery open for 48 weeks of the year. Minibus service.
